Agelasine D Suppresses RANKL-Induced Osteoclastogenesis via Down-Regulation of c-Fos, NFATc1 and NF-κB
In the present study, we investigated the effect of agelasine D (AD) on osteoclastogenesis. Treatment of bone marrow macrophages (BMMs) with receptor activator of nuclear factor κB ligand (RANKL) resulted in a differentiation of BMMs into osteoclasts as evidenced by generation of tartrate-resistant...
